Simplified Explanation

The patent application describes a window type air conditioner with an outdoor module, an indoor module, a refrigerant pipe, and a connection support module.

  • The outdoor module includes a compressor, an outdoor heat exchanger, and an outdoor housing.
  • The indoor module includes an indoor heat exchanger and an indoor housing spaced apart from the outdoor housing.
  • The refrigerant pipe allows refrigerant to move between the indoor and outdoor modules.
  • The connection support module connects and supports the positional relationship between the indoor and outdoor modules.
  • The refrigerant pipe extends through the first connection rod of the connection support module, with a sealing member forming a seal between the pipe and the rod.

Original Abstract Submitted

a window type air conditioner including an outdoor module including a compressor, an outdoor heat exchanger, and an outdoor housing; an indoor module including an indoor heat exchanger, and an indoor housing spaced apart from the outdoor housing; a refrigerant pipe through which refrigerant moves between the indoor and the outdoor module; and a connection support module including a first connection rod having an inner circumferential surface, and a sealing member inside the first connection rod, wherein the connection support module connects, and supports a positional relationship between, the indoor and the outdoor module, the refrigerant pipe extends through the first connection rod so that an inner circumferential surface of the first connection rod is spaced apart from an outer circumferential surface of the refrigerant pipe, and the sealing member is arranged to form a seal between the refrigerant pipe and the first connection rod.
